Electrician Salary in East Midlands
The East Midlands offers some of the UK's most affordable living combined with a diverse employment base spanning logistics, manufacturing, food production and professional services. Salaries are generally 10-20% below the national median.
Among the most affordable UK regions for housing, offering strong purchasing power. The cost-of-living advantage can offset lower nominal salaries.
Salary Trajectory
| Stage | Years Exp | P25 | Median | P75 | P90 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Apprentice Electrician | 0+ | £13,160 | £16,920 | £20,680 | £22,560 |
| Qualified Electrician | 4+ | £29,046 | £32,900 | £37,600 | £42,300 |
| Experienced Electrician | 8+ | £32,900 | £36,848 | £45,496 | £49,820 |
| Supervisor / Foreman | 12+ | £37,600 | £43,240 | £48,880 | £53,862 |
| Electrical Contractor / Manager | 16+ | £45,120 | £51,700 | £61,100 | £73,320 |
